read the original abstract

We study solutions of the reflection equation associated with the quantum affine algebra $U_{q}(\hat{gl}(N))$ and obtain diagonal K-operators in terms of the Cartan elements of a quotient of $U_{q}(gl(N))$. We also consider intertwining relations for these K-operators and find an augmented q-Onsager algebra like symmetry behind them.
